There are two practical ways to get started: Online Vastu Advice and an On-Site Vastu Visit. Each has its strengths and fits different moments in a project — one is fast and remote-friendly, the other allows detailed environmental study and energy scanning during a live visit.
Most people begin by reaching out through the website, a message, or a quick call. You’ll share a floor plan, the compass directions, photos, and sometimes a video walkthrough or a live video call. That material becomes the basis for a remote review: layout, entry and room usage are assessed and suggestions are given for changes, furniture placement, and design priorities.
Online consultations are based on drawings, directions, photographs and Dr. Kunal’s many years of experience and research — however, no live on-site energy scanning is done in an online-only consultation. Recommendations arrive as a conversational review, annotated plans and a follow-up call so you understand both the “what” and the “why.”
When the situation needs it — a complex site, persistent concerns, or a large project — Dr. Kunal visits in person. He observes directions, proportions, how each room is used, and talks with the family or team about practical routines. This visit includes detailed environmental work using the Geo Energy Analysis Software System.
During an On-Site Vastu Visit he may scan for Bhoomi Ki Urja (Earth Vibrations), Cosmic Vibrations, Parallel Vibrations, Environmental Radiations, EMR/EMF/EMW/RF, Geopathic Stress and other subtle environmental influences. These readings are explained simply and linked to practical paths forward, prioritising non-demolition remedies where possible.
In short: Online Vastu Advice is thorough for plan-driven questions and early-stage guidance; an On-Site Vastu Visit brings environmental scanning and a hands-on study of the place where you live or work. Both formats are designed to give you usable choices.
